Project Nourish 2026: Food Distribution Initiative

On Sunday, September 27, 2026, we are hosting our annual food distribution event to support individuals and families affected by food insecurity.

Registration is available for residents of the City of Toronto. This includes the areas of Etobicoke, York, North York, Toronto, East York and Scarborough.

SLOW MOTION

Guided by certified yoga instructor Amanda Silvera Thomas, you will be taken through a series of Hatha and Yin yoga poses to a handpicked playlist set to deepen the mind and body connection.

This beginner-friendly class offers a welcoming space for self-discovery and rejuvenation followed by a social hour for attendees to connect with a likeminded community.

Meet Amanda Silvera Thomas

Amanda Silvera Thomas is a Yoga Teacher and Costume Designer whose work is rooted in creativity, embodiment, and connection. As a 200-hour certified yoga teacher, she brings
together her experience in the fast-paced worlds of film and fashion with her passion for mindful movement, creating spaces that invite people to slow down, reconnect, and come home to their bodies.

Through yoga, breathwork, mindfulness, and music, Amanda’s offerings blend grounding practices with rhythm, self-expression, and joy. Her classes are designed to support stress relief, nervous system regulation, and deeper presence while creating an atmosphere that feels restorative, inclusive, and deeply human.

Inspired by the belief that movement is a form of storytelling and self-care, Amanda invites participants to release external noise, reconnect with themselves, and experience the body as a place of balance, healing, and connection both on and beyond the mat.

RESET: Care Without Burnout

Join us for a holistic workshop facilitated by Nadeisha Pinnock, an Advanced Practice Mental Health Nurse, as we explore the role of a caregiver while learning how to manage and protect your mental health. The session will conclude with an aromatherapy activity where attendees will create helpful essential oil blends that encourage calm, grounding and soothing.
